我正在执行以下python代码
a=1
b=2
"bigger" if a>b else "smaller"
1)当我在Python的控制台窗口中执行时,我得到的结果为 - > '较小' 2)当我把它放在一个python文件并执行时,我没有得到任何结果(没有错误) 你能提供一些提示吗?
答案 0 :(得分:4)
在Python控制台中,它会自动打印代码返回的内容。运行文件时,必须自己打印结果。要在运行文件时显示代码,您必须使用print(<code>)
。试试这个文件:
a=1
b=2
print("bigger" if a>b else "smaller")